Chelation Science and Technical Advantages

Metal chelation fundamentally transforms micronutrient bioavailability through protective ligand bonds that prevent precipitation in alkaline soils. EDTA, EDDHA, and DTPA chelating agents demonstrate variable stability constants ranging from 18.8 to 25.0 pH units, creating targeted solutions for specific soil conditions. Third-party validation confirms amino acid-chelated alternatives increase zinc assimilation by 74% in high-carbonate environments. Crucially, modern manufacturing preserves chelate integrity during granulation processes, maintaining molecular bond stability at temperatures exceeding 85°C.

Documented Performance Metrics

Commercial validation demonstrates consistent yield improvement patterns when specific chelation protocols are implemented:

  • Brazilian sugarcane: Mn-EDTA foliar applications increased sucrose yield by 2.7 tons/hectare during 3-year study
  • Canadian canola: Boron-amino acid complex boosted oil content 4.1% at identical application rates
  • Vietnamese rice paddies: Zn-DTPA reduced deficiency symptoms in 92% of trial plots despite alkaline flooding conditions

Researchers at Punjab Agricultural University documented accelerated nutrient mobilization using Fe-EDDHA formulations in calcareous soils, reducing chlorosis reversal time by 18 days compared to sulphate alternatives.
